Safi is Morocco's best-kept secret—a collection of world-class right-hand point breaks that rival anything in the more famous Taghazout zone, but with a fraction of the crowds. The industrial fishing port backdrop may lack the charm of southern Morocco's surf villages, but the waves more than compensate. Long, mechanical walls peel along the rocky points, offering extended rides and genuine quality when Atlantic groundswells light up the coast. For those willing to venture beyond the well-worn Taghazout path, Safi rewards with uncrowded perfection.

Access: Multiple access points along coast.
Safi works best on a mid tide, ideally between 0.5m and 2m on the local tide chart. The tide chart above shows today’s strike window.
Offshore wind at Safi blows from the E (90°). Anything in the 45° to 135° range grooms the faces; outside it, expect chop or bumpy conditions.
Safi wants NW swell (280° to 340°) between 0.8m and 3m, with a period of 14s or more for quality waves.
The main season at Safi is Oct, Nov, Dec, Jan, Feb, Mar. A secondary window runs Apr, Sep. October-March Atlantic swells.
Fly into ESU, then allow about 90 minutes by road. Multiple access points along coast.
Safi is a point break, a right-hander. Difficulty is rated 5/10.
